Policy Developments Federal Policy Developments Not committed to ratifying Kyoto Protocol Climate Change partnership with USA Still funding AGO and associated programs State Gov Policy Developments NSW EPA released draft guidelines for EIA’s VIC EPA - Greenhouse emissions part of licence compliance (existing licences & works approvals) QLD EPA - developing guidelines for same WA EPA - released guidelines and may veto projects

GH Emissions of Electricity Electricity contributes 172 Million Tonnes CO2e p.a. in Australia 37.5% Equivalent to 37.5% of Australia’s Emissions

Electricity GH Trends Electricity consumption rising Largest contributor to emissions - 37.5% in 1999 Emissions increase by 33% over 1990 levels One plank of strategy - Renewable Energy Others include: Generator Efficiency standards Demand Side Management (energy efficiency) MEPS - appliances, hot water heaters, etc. Cogen? Emissions Trading, Others?
